<br />May 20, 2019, Work Session – Item 2 <br />Planning Commission Review of Draft Code Language Planning Commission reviewed draft land use code language for Batch 1 issues at a work session in February 2019 and Batch 2 issues during three work sessions in April 2019. The items covered in each batch are listed below. For the proposed language, staff reviewed the related key issues and provided the approved preferred concept for context, before the commission opened the item for discussion. At the end of the discussion, a straw poll to determine support for each recommendation was taken. Batch 1 Items: <br />• All Maintenance Issues <br />• 30-Foot Buffer Requirement for PUDs (COS-02) <br />• Emergency Response (COS-08) <br />• Conditional Use Requirement (COS-09) <br />• Partition Tree Preservation (COS-10) <br />• Site Review Requirement (COS-12) <br />• 19 Lot Rule—Motor Vehicle Dispersal (COS-14) <br />• PUD Requirement (COS-16) <br />• Arborist and Landscape Architect Requirement (COS-18) <br />• Pedestrian Definition (COS-20) <br /> Batch 2 Items: <br />• Clear & Objective Compatibility (COS-01) <br />• 20 Percent Slope Grading Prohibition for ST & PUD (COS-03) <br />• One Acre Accessible Open Space for PUDs (COS-04) <br />• Limitation Over 900 Feet for PUDs (South Hills) (COS-05) <br />• Ridgeline Setback for PUDs (South Hills) (COS-06) <br />• 40 Percent Open Space Requirement for PUDs (South Hills) (COS-07) <br />• Tree Preservation Consideration (COS-11) <br />• Geotechnical Requirement (COS-13) <br />• Street Standards Modifications (COS-19) A summary of Planning Commission’s review of draft code language is provided in Attachment B and draft land use code language is included in Attachment C. <br /> <br />Next Steps The formal adoption process will include a Planning Commission public hearing and recommendation to City Council, followed by City Council public hearing and action.
